你查询的IP:[118.89.107.71]  地理位置:中国–上海–上海

最新查询221.8.92.97 125.62.196.83 60.200.58.145 119.62.161.14 210.12.141.88 218.97.223.60 121.136.16.68 221.76.173.81 121.56.46.197 118.89.107.71 202.127.160.53 202.38.149.23 203.119.32.65 218.20.156.13 118.144.241.223 116.213.128.42 202.74.110.131 123.138.150.217 203.118.192.181 119.41.186.82 117.74.128.119 120.48.151.67 119.3.63.101 119.27.160.202 120.94.190.14 202.171.176.74 60.247.52.133 221.199.142.26 220.242.25.166 202.165.208.250 118.66.185.16